Logo
TSR Consulting

Senior Cloud Developer

TSR Consulting, St Louis, Missouri, United States

Save Job

About TSR:

TSR is a relationship-based, customer-focused IT and technical services staffing company.

For over 40 years TSR, Inc. and its wholly owned subsidiary, TSR Consulting Services, have prospered in the Information Technology staffing business, earning the respect of companies both large and small with well refined candidate screening, timely placement, and a real understanding of the right skill sets required by our clients.

Mission & Vision

We do not believe in building a vision around the company but building a company around our vision, which is simply;

Every employee's voice matters, their effort is appreciated, and their talent is rewarded.

We challenge each employee daily, to raise the bar on how we treat our consultants and candidates. For far too long in this industry, candidates have been ghosted, lied to, or placed at a client and then forgotten about. Each day our staff works tirelessly at qualifying and placing, top talent with our clients, in a compassionate and caring manner.

Not every candidate is a match for the job, but every candidate and consultant will be treated with respect and professionalism.

Senior Cloud Developer

Job Description

Location: St. Louis, Missouri Remote: Remote Type: Contract Job #83113 Our client, a leading financial company, is hiring a Senior Cloud Developer on a contract basis

Job ID #:

83113

Work Location : Remote

Summary:

Senior Cloud Developer

We are seeking a highly experienced Senior Cloud Developer with over 5 years of hands-on experience in both Microsoft Azure and Google Cloud Platform (GCP).

The ideal candidate will have deep expertise in automating and deploying IaaS and PaaS services using Terraform, developing reusable Terraform modules/libraries, and building robust CI/CD pipelines using GitHub Actions.

Strong scripting skills in PowerShell, Python, and Bash are essential.

Experience with Azure API Management (APIM), Azure OpenAI, and GCP services such as Vertex AI and Cloud Run is required.

Key Responsibilities: Azure Responsibilities:

Design and automate deployment of Azure IaaS and PaaS services using Terraform.

Develop and maintain modular, reusable Terraform modules for Azure infrastructure.

Implement and manage CI/CD pipelines using GitHub Actions for Azure deployments.

Automate operational tasks using PowerShell, Python, and Bash.

Deploy and manage services such as Azure VMs, App Services, Azure App Gateway, Azure Functions, SQLDB, Azure SQL, Postgres DB, Mongo DB, AKS, Key Vault, APIM, and Azure OpenAI.

Integrate Azure OpenAI capabilities into cloud-native applications and workflows. GCP Responsibilities:

Design and automate deployment of GCP IaaS and PaaS services using Terraform.

Build and maintain Terraform modules/libraries for scalable GCP infrastructure.

Deploy and manage services like Vertex AI, Cloud Run, Compute Engine, Cloud Functions, App Engine, GKE, BigQuery, and Cloud Storage.

Integrate GCP services into CI/CD pipelines using GitHub Actions.

Automate infrastructure and service provisioning using scripting languages.

Act with integrity, professionalism, and personal responsibility to uphold the firm's respectful and courteous work environment.

Pay Range: $74-75